Argentina's FIFA-licensed commemorative program for the 2014 Brazil World Cup carried particular weight domestically — the Argentine national team had last won the tournament in 1986, and anticipation for the Messi-era squad was running unusually high in the lead-up to the tournament. The Casa de Moneda issued this piece in 2013 as part of a broader regional wave of official commemoratives authorized under FIFA's commercial licensing arrangements with participating nations' mints.
Argentina would reach the final in Brazil, losing to Germany 1–0 in extra time.
